Hahn, Martin, Jensen, Craig, and Dudek, Bruce (editors) - Development and Evolution of Brain Size: Behavioral Implications.

New York: Academic Press, 1979. First edition. Pp. xvii, 393; some text-figures (graphs and line-drawings). Publisher's original gray cloth, lettered in white on the spine, lg 8vo. Based on a symposium held at William Patterson College, this volume presents 18 chapters by notable authorities in the field. The volume covers all aspects of brain size and development in primates and other mammals. Small signature of former owner on the front endpaper. No signs of use.
